Reassessing Transketolase Assays: Methodological Considerations for Detecting Functional Thiamine Deficiency

open access: yesAnnals of the New York Academy of Sciences, Volume 1557, Issue 1, March 2026.
Transketolase (TKT) activity provides a functional measure of thiamine status by integrating cofactor availability, enzyme abundance, and catalytic capacity. TKT catalyzes thiamine diphosphate (TDP)‐dependent reactions in the nonoxidative pentose‐phosphate pathway and requires magnesium for optimal activity.

Moderate Regulation of SBEIIb Gene Expression by Editing Cis‐Regulatory Elements Enhances the Resistant Starch Content in Rice

open access: yesPlant Biotechnology Journal, Volume 24, Issue 3, Page 1635-1648, March 2026.
ABSTRACT As the staple food of over half the world's population, rice with a high resistant starch (RS) content may be beneficial in the dietary prevention of diabetes and hyperlipidemia. Mutating key enzymes in starch metabolism to increase the RS content has been successful in other crops.

Evidence for rapid hydrolysis of shoot‐derived sucrose using an ultrasensitive ratiometric matryoshka‐type MGlucoMeter sensor

open access: yesThe Plant Journal, Volume 125, Issue 5, March 2026.
Significance Statement MGlucoMeter, a high‐sensitivity ratiometric genetically encoded sensor, can report changes in glucose levels in live cells and organisms. Here, MGlucoMeter detected the hydrolysis of leaf‐derived sucrose in the root tip unloading zone.
